
QT
文章平均质量分 71
QT
ᴇʀɪᴄ ᴛᴇᴏ
什么都略懂一点,生活就会多彩一点。
展开
-
009 - 交叉编译 Qt5.12
交叉编译 Qt5.12文章目录交叉编译 Qt5.12前言准备 sysroot基础镜像安装需要的依赖库安装自己要用的工具创建 pkgconfig 软链接退出 qemu 环境处理软链接主机安装编译工具交叉编译工具链安装编译需要的环境编译Qt配置 mkspecsconfiguremakemake installWebEngine去掉qt库交叉编译信息目前遇到的问题eglfsqmake附件附件1 c.py 脚本附件2 convert2target.sh 脚本前言之前我说了一句,就算板子性能再弱,编译需要的时间原创 2022-03-30 20:42:47 · 1592 阅读 · 0 评论 -
008 - windeployqt 打包程序
windeployqt 打包程序打包程序注意编译工具要使用对应的发布工具%QT_DIR% 和 %QT_VERSION% 替换为自己的实际路径即可在自己的可执行文件 xxx.exe 路径下打开命令行执行完之后就会发现多了很多东西,可以愉快的打包了MSVC这个其实没什么说的%QT_DIR%\%QT_VERSION%\msvc2017_64\bin\windeployqt.exe xxx.exeMinGW需要将 MinGW bin 目录添加到环境变量,不然打包会出问题%QT_DIR%\%Q原创 2022-03-30 20:42:16 · 234 阅读 · 0 评论 -
007 - 配置 Clion 调试显示 Qt 变量
配置 Clion 调试显示 Qt 变量文章目录配置 Clion 调试显示 Qt 变量引言尝试解决配置Lekensteyn's qt5printersKDevelop formatters for GDB配置完成之后的效果问题及解决附录A 测试代码附件参考文章引言众所周知,Clion 写 C++ 是真的爽,但是写 QT 是 2020.3 及其以后版本官方才做了一定的支持,但是调试过程中还是看不到 QT 变量,只能看到 d 指针地址,不信你看 👇👇👇使用 Qt Creator 的时候就就能看到里面的值原创 2022-03-30 20:40:15 · 3560 阅读 · 5 评论 -
006 - Windows 下 C++ 程序以管理员运行(UAC)
Windows 下 C++ 程序以管理员运行(UAC)MSVC 编译器qmake在 pro 文件中添加一行指令即可,QMAKE_LFLAGS += /MANIFESTUAC:"level='requireAdministrator'uiAccess='false'"cmakeset_target_properties(${PROJECT_NAME} PROPERTIES LINK_FLAGS "/MANIFESTUAC:\"level='requireAdministrato原创 2022-03-30 20:39:29 · 2088 阅读 · 0 评论 -
006 - 编译 QtWebEngine
编译 QtWebEngine文章目录编译 QtWebEngine前言源码下载编译安装编译过程中可能遇到的问题参考文档前言在之前的文章《Linux 安装 Qt》中,我说了一句 QtWenEngine 模块不好编译,暂时用不到就不管,可没想到苍天饶过谁,这么快就需要用 QtWenEngine 了,能怎么办,编呗,接着编……源码下载之前的 qt 源码里面有 webengine 的源码编译安装根据官方文档,先安装依赖库;根据官方推荐安装的,咱也不知道对不对,主要是这玩意太难编译了,就宁可多装一千,不能原创 2022-03-30 20:38:15 · 6163 阅读 · 7 评论 -
005 - 编译安装 QtCreator
编译安装 QtCreator参考官方文档 https://wiki.qt.io/Building_Qt_Creator_from_Git下载源码https://download.qt.io/official_releases/qtcreator/源码下载目录说明或者国内镜像可以参考之前的文章《Linux 安装 QT》因为我自己编译的 qt 是 5.12 版本的,所以我下载的是 4.13 版本的 qt creator我是下载下来看了 readme 才知道需要的 qt 版本;不知道有没有其他办法使原创 2021-06-24 10:30:56 · 4833 阅读 · 0 评论 -
004 - Linux Qt 使用搜狗输入法
Linux Qt 使用搜狗输入法文章目录Linux Qt 使用搜狗输入法前言解决方案Qt Creator 使用搜狗输入法Qt 生成的应用使用搜狗输入法前言不出意外的话,Qt 是不能使用搜狗输入法的,状态栏都看不到那种。主要是搜狗输入法使用的是小企鹅(fcitx) 输入框架,Qt 默认没有集成。解决方案将小企鹅输入法扩展复制到相应的路径下Qt Creator 使用搜狗输入法复制小企鹅扩展到 Qt Creator 相应路径下$QtDir为自己 Qt 的安装路径cd $QtDir/Tools/原创 2021-06-04 13:34:52 · 2149 阅读 · 2 评论 -
003 - Clion 创建 Qt UI Class 踩坑
Clion 创建 Qt UI Class 踩坑注意 UI 类名和文件名关系创建 UI 类 MainWindow;文件标红,按照提示先 build 一下build 报错所以新建 UI 类的时候要确保 Name 和 Filename base 大小写要保持一致使用 Qt Designer 无法拖拽控件到 Window原因对比使用 Qt Creator 直接创建的 ui 文件,发现 clion 创建的缺少了 ‘<widget class=“QWidget” name=“centralWid原创 2021-06-04 13:33:38 · 2088 阅读 · 3 评论 -
002 - 配置 Clion Qt 开发环境
配置 Clion Qt 开发环境文章目录配置 Clion Qt 开发环境安装配置 ClionExternal ToolsFile and Code TemplatesCMake文件打包Qt应用程序安装Qt 下载http://download.qt.io/archive/qt/安装Windows添加Tools需要选择MinGW,添加环境变量Linux参考Linux 安装 QT/usr/lib/x86_64-linux-gnu/qtchooser/default.conf第一行Qt原创 2021-06-04 13:32:50 · 868 阅读 · 0 评论 -
001 - Linux 安装/编译 QT
Linux 安装 QT文章目录Linux 安装 QT离线安装版下载Qt 官方下载国内镜像站下载安装安装后配置源码编译安装下载源码编译安装第一次使用可能出现的问题离线安装版离线安装没有 Arm 架构的,且 5.15 版本开始就不提供离线安装包了下载Qt 官方下载地址:http://download.qt.io/可能会打不开且下载巨慢,不详细阐述国内镜像站下载国内著名的几个 Qt 镜像网站中国科学技术大学:http://mirrors.ustc.edu.cn/qtproject/清华大学原创 2021-06-04 13:31:46 · 1133 阅读 · 0 评论